The Power of Flavor: Unlocking Your Sparkling Water Potential

The secret to making sparkling water taste like soda lies in understanding the different ways to add flavor. Think of it like a blank canvas – you can create a masterpiece with the right tools! Here are the key players in your flavoring journey:

1. Fruit Infusions: A classic and delicious way to add natural sweetness and vibrant flavors. Simply slice your favorite fruits (think berries, citrus, melon, or even cucumber) and let them steep in your sparkling water for a few hours. You can experiment with different combinations to create unique flavor profiles.

2. Herbal Infusions: For a more subtle and refreshing twist, try infusing your sparkling water with herbs like mint, basil, rosemary, or even lavender. These herbs add a touch of complexity and natural aroma to your drink.

3. Flavor Syrups: These concentrated syrups are a quick and easy way to add bold flavors to your sparkling water. You can find a wide variety of flavors, from classic cola and fruit punch to more exotic options like chai and lavender. Just a splash of syrup is all you need to transform your water into a delicious soda.

4. Fruit Purees: For a thicker, more intense flavor, try blending your favorite fruits into a puree and adding it to your sparkling water. This method creates a more decadent experience, similar to a smoothie.

Unleash Your Inner Mixologist: Sparkling Water Recipes

Now that you’ve got the basics, let’s get creative! Here are some easy and delicious recipes to get you started:

1. Berry Bliss:

  • Ingredients: 1 cup of mixed berries (strawberries, raspberries, blueberries), 1/2 cup of water, sparkling water.
  • Instructions: Blend the berries and water until smooth. Pour the puree into a glass filled with ice and top with sparkling water.

2. Citrus Zest:

  • Ingredients: 1/2 cup of lemon juice, 1/4 cup of orange juice, sparkling water.
  • Instructions: Mix the lemon and orange juice in a glass filled with ice. Add sparkling water to taste.

3. Cucumber Mint Refresher:

  • Ingredients: 1/2 cucumber, sliced, 1/2 cup of mint leaves, sparkling water.
  • Instructions: Muddle the cucumber and mint leaves in a glass. Add ice and top with sparkling water.

4. Tropical Paradise:

  • Ingredients: 1/2 cup of pineapple chunks, 1/4 cup of mango chunks, sparkling water.
  • Instructions: Blend the pineapple and mango until smooth. Pour the puree into a glass filled with ice and top with sparkling water.

Beyond the Basics: Taking Your Sparkling Water Game to the Next Level

Once you’ve mastered the basics, there are endless possibilities for customizing your sparkling water concoctions. Here are some tips to elevate your flavoring game:

1. Experiment with Spices: Add a pinch of cinnamon, ginger, or cardamom to your fruit infusions for a warm and comforting twist.

2. Use Fresh Herbs: Instead of buying pre-made syrups, try infusing your own with fresh herbs. This allows you to control the sweetness and create unique flavor combinations.

3. Try Different Carbonation Levels: Some sparkling waters are more bubbly than others. Experiment with different brands to find the perfect level of fizz for your taste.

4. Get Creative with Garnishes: Add a sprig of mint, a slice of citrus, or a few berries to your glass for a beautiful and flavorful touch.

Basics You Wanted To Know

1. Can I use frozen fruit for infusions?

Absolutely! Frozen fruit can actually be a great option for infusions, especially if you want a more concentrated flavor. Just be sure to let the fruit thaw slightly before adding it to your water.

2. How long do fruit infusions last?

Fruit infusions are best enjoyed fresh, but they can last in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. The flavor will start to diminish after that time, so it’s best to make a new batch every day.

3. Can I make my own flavor syrups?

Yes! Making your own syrups is a fun and easy way to customize your flavors. Simply combine sugar, water, and your desired flavoring agent (fruit, herbs, spices) in a saucepan and simmer until the sugar dissolves. Let the syrup cool completely before using.

4. What’s the best way to store flavored sparkling water?

Store flavored sparkling water in the refrigerator for maximum freshness. You can also freeze leftover infusions in ice cube trays for later use. Simply add a few infused ice cubes to your sparkling water for a refreshing and flavorful drink.

5. Can I use sparkling water in cocktails?

Definitely! Sparkling water is a great alternative to soda in cocktails, adding a refreshing fizz without the extra sugar. Try substituting sparkling water for soda in your favorite gin and tonic or rum and coke recipes.
